## Partner SFTP Drop — Marlowe Freight

Files land nightly between 02:00–03:30 UTC in the inbound drop. Watcher job `marlowe-ingest` picks them up; if nothing arrives by 04:00, the Quillhook alert fires. Do NOT re-request files from Marlowe before checking the quarantine folder — malformed headers get parked there silently. Retries are safe; ingest is idempotent on file checksum. Rotation of the drop credentials is quarterly, owned by platform. Full escalation steps and contacts are on the runbook page.

dashboard of taduf-tahof = https://confluence.tolvaqlabs.internal/browse/browse/display/f01240ca

Turnstile counter at Harlow Field reports via the GateSum service. If the GateSum admin account locks after three failed logins, reset through the Varnik console, not the kiosk. Verify counter drift is under 50 before re-enabling feeds. Console reset requires the recovery passphrase on file, shown below.

recovery phrase for fajep-yaweg: gilath-sorox-wenius-rusdor-keliel-zorius

## Deployment

Feecraft, our shipping-fee rules engine, deploys as a single container behind the Harmon gateway. Rules reload hot; no restart needed after publishing a ruleset. Support: if a merchant reports wrong fees, first confirm the active ruleset version in the admin panel, then check region overrides. Rollbacks take about two minutes and are self-serve. Staging mirrors prod except for currency rounding. The deployment ships with these configuration values.

config for kafof-bawef:
holath:
  log_level: debug
  metrics_host: metrics.holath.qorvelsys.internal
  pin: 2191
  pool_size: 32

## Deployment

Following the Marlowe stale-cache incident, deploys now purge the edge cache before routing traffic to new pods, not after. The postmortem showed the old ordering served week-old payloads for up to nine minutes. Rollouts are gated on a purge-confirmation check. For the sync: the current production values are listed directly below.

settings of kagag-kagef:
[kelath]
port = 9300
region = west-4
host = kelath.olvarqworks.example
team = sorion
timeout_ms = 1000
retries = 8